[0002] At present, when carrying out chemistry teaching in schools, on-site chemical demonstration experiments are one of the necessary teaching contents, but in chemical demonstration experiments, many experiments will produce smoke or harmful and toxic gases, and the experiments are required to be carried out in a fume hood. Large-scale instruments such as fume hoods are not equipped in many school laboratories. Even if they are equipped, they cannot be brought to the classroom for demonstration experiments. For experiments that produce smoke and harmful and toxic gases, teachers can only carry out experiments without any protective measures. , which not only affects the effect of teaching, but also causes great harm to the health of teachers and students. Therefore, the demand for a chemical element analysis device is increasing day by day
[0003] Most of the demonstration devices for chemical elements currently on the market are fixed and non-adjustable, which will make some students who are far away cannot see the effect of the experiment and affect the effect of teaching; Safe design leads to some safety hazards in the experiment process; there are also some element demonstration devices used in chemical experiments, which do not filter and collect harmful gases that may be generated in the experiment, which not only endangers people's health, but also pollutes the environment. environment, etc. Therefore, a chemical element analysis device is proposed to address the above problems

Abstract

The invention relates to the technical field of experimental teaching, in particular to a chemical element analysis device. The chemical element analysis device includes a demonstration platform. Theupper end face of the demonstration platform is fixedly connected with a demonstration box. The left end face of the demonstration box is fixedly connected with a fixing plate. The right side of the fixing plate is fixedly connected with a fixing ring. A baffle is arranged on the right side of the fixing ring. The left end face of the baffle is fixedly connected with a rubber layer. The right endface of the fixing plate is fixedly connected with a spring. The inner side of the right end face of the demonstration box is fixedly connected with an exhaust fan. The bottom end of the exhaust fan is communicated with an exhaust pipe. The other end of the exhaust pipe is fixedly connected with a gas collecting bottle. Through the fixing plate, the baffle, the exhaust fan and the gas collecting bottle, harmful gas produced during experiment can be collected and handled. Thus, the human health will not be harmed, and the environment will not be polluted. The design is novel and scientific.
